Product Description:
The FC-302PK37T5E20H1XGXXXXSXXXXAN is a variable frequency drive produced by Danfoss for the VLT FC 302 Automation Drives series. As part of a cabinet-mounted control system, it converts fixed-frequency supply power into a modulated output that allows automation controllers to vary motor speed and torque. This capability supports material-handling, pump, and fan applications where matching mechanical output to real-time process demand can improve energy use and reduce mechanical stress. The drive can regulate connected induction motors across a range of operating speeds while responding to commands from local or networked controls.
The drive has a continuous rating of 0.37 kW, which corresponds to 0.50 HP of motor output under steady operating conditions. Incoming utility power may range from 380 to 500 VAC, allowing the unit to operate on common low-voltage industrial networks without a transformer. It uses three-phase power, which is compatible with typical industrial power distribution systems. The IP20 chassis enclosure is intended for installation inside a ventilated electrical panel and helps prevent accidental contact with live components. Standard cabinet-mounting hardware is supported for the applicable A, B, and C frame sizes. The design does not include an internal brake chopper, so it is intended for applications that do not require integrated dynamic braking.
Field integration can be handled through the optional EtherNet/IP MCA 121 interface, which supports high-speed network control and diagnostic communication. Local parameter access is provided by the Graphical Local Control Panel, where users can view operating status, alarms, and setup menus. The panel uses a factory-loaded Standard language pack for menu navigation and drive configuration. Conducted emissions are limited by the built-in RFI Class A1/B (C1) filter, helping the drive meet applicable interference requirements when installed correctly. Standard cable entries support power, motor, and control wiring within the cabinet. The drive has an uncoated printed circuit board and does not include a dedicated mains disconnect or special adaptation modules, leaving external isolation and application-specific accessories to the surrounding control system.
